Do new interior doors increase home value?
Updating the interior doors of a home can have a significant impact on its overall value. While it may seem like a small change, new doors can enhance the aesthetic appeal of a space and leave a lasting impression on potential buyers. So, to answer the burning question – yes, new interior doors can indeed increase the value of your home.
Replacing old, outdated doors with fresh, modern ones can elevate the look and feel of a home. Whether you opt for sleek and contemporary styles or classic, traditional designs, updated doors can make a noticeable difference in the overall appearance of a room. These improvements can attract more buyers and potentially increase the selling price of your home.
In addition to aesthetics, new interior doors can also improve functionality. Doors that are old or damaged may not operate smoothly or provide adequate privacy and sound insulation. By installing new, high-quality doors, you can enhance the functionality of your living space and create a more comfortable environment for you and your family.
Investing in new interior doors is a relatively affordable way to upgrade your home and increase its value. Compared to larger renovation projects, such as kitchen remodels or room additions, replacing doors is a cost-effective way to make a big impact. Additionally, with a wide range of options available, you can find doors that fit your budget and style preferences.
When considering the value of new interior doors, it’s essential to think about the overall cohesive look of your home. Matching doors throughout the interior can create a sense of unity and flow, improving the overall appeal of your living space. Consistent design elements can give your home a polished and well-thought-out appearance that buyers will appreciate.
In conclusion, new interior doors have the potential to increase the value of your home by improving its aesthetics, functionality, and overall appeal. Whether you’re looking to sell your home or simply update its look, investing in new doors can have a positive impact on your property’s value.
FAQs:
1. Are there different types of interior doors to choose from?
Yes, there are various types of interior doors, including solid wood, hollow core, and glass-paneled doors.
2. How do I know which type of interior door is best for my home?
Consider factors such as budget, style preferences, and functionality needs when choosing the right interior doors for your home.
3. Can I install new interior doors myself, or should I hire a professional?
While it is possible to install new interior doors yourself, hiring a professional can ensure proper installation and a finished look.
4. Do interior doors come in standard sizes, or can they be customized?
Interior doors typically come in standard sizes, but custom sizes can also be made to fit specific spaces in your home.
5. How long does it take to replace all the interior doors in a home?
The time it takes to replace interior doors can vary depending on the number of doors and the complexity of the installation process. It could take anywhere from a few days to a week.
6. Are there eco-friendly options available for new interior doors?
Yes, there are eco-friendly interior door options made from sustainable materials such as bamboo or reclaimed wood.
7. Can new interior doors improve energy efficiency in a home?
High-quality doors with proper insulation can help improve energy efficiency by reducing drafts and improving temperature regulation in a home.
8. Do interior doors affect the acoustics of a room?
Yes, solid-core doors are better at providing sound insulation and can help reduce noise transmission between rooms.
9. Can changing the door hardware make a difference in the overall look of a room?
Yes, updating door hardware such as handles and hinges can enhance the aesthetic appeal of a room and complement the style of new doors.
10. Will painting interior doors myself provide the same value increase as replacing them?
While a fresh coat of paint can improve the appearance of interior doors, replacing them entirely can have a more significant impact on home value.
11. Do new interior doors require any special maintenance or care?
New interior doors typically require minimal maintenance, such as periodic cleaning and lubrication of hinges for smooth operation.
12. Can new interior doors increase the resale value of my home even if I don’t plan to sell it soon?
Yes, investing in new interior doors can enhance the overall value, appeal, and functionality of your home, even if you don’t plan on selling it in the near future.
